Industrial Buildings
Industrial buildings are designed to accommodate manufacturing, production and operational activities with layouts that support functionality, durability and efficient use of space.
Warehouse Infrastructure
Warehouse facilities provide organized storage, efficient material movement and operational support while maintaining flexibility for changing industrial requirements.
Utility & Site Development
Supporting infrastructure including internal roads, drainage systems, utility corridors and site development creates a reliable foundation for industrial facilities.
